Bickley station features a well-equipped ticket office, open from early morning until late evening on weekdays, with more limited hours on weekends. If you're in a hurry, you can grab your tickets from the machines available on-site. The station also supports modern travel solutions with accessible smartcard facilities for swift entry and exit. Importantly, induction loops are installed for those who require auditory assistance.
While the station provides waiting rooms with heating, open only during ticket office hours, it does lack some conveniences, such as toilets and baby changing facilities. However, it compensates with a coffee shop, vending machines for refreshments, and newspapers available for purchase, ensuring you won’t board your train empty-handed.
Accessibility is a consideration at Bickley station, though it's worth noting it falls under Category C, meaning there is no step-free access. Passengers requiring mobility assistance can benefit from available ramps, dedicated help points, and staffed hours that coincide with ticket office operations. Assistance is readily available during these hours, but for the best experience, booking assistance in advance is recommended, ensuring a smooth journey from start to finish. Should staff be unavailable, there's a mobile assistance team to rely on.

Earlswood (Surrey) Train Station ensures a smooth ticketing experience with its convenient ticket office, operational weekdays from 06:30 to 10:45, and ticket machines available 24/7 for all your travel needs. It's reassuring to know that tickets bought online can be easily collected here. The station proudly accommodates passengers requiring accessibility features, boasting disabled-friendly ticket machines and induction loops for hearing aid users. However, note that step-free access is only available to platform 1.
The station is equipped with helplines and customer service points, providing real-time information and assistance to travelers. There is also CCTV surveillance ensuring a secure environment. While the station lacks a waiting room and first-class lounges, it provides a seating area for comfort before your journey. Refreshment facilities are on hand to make waiting times more enjoyable, although there are no ATMs or shopping outlets available currently.
Getting to and from Earlswood (Surrey) Station is seamless with multiple transport links. There are options for buses and a rail replacement service should you need them, providing flexibility for urban or countryside explorations. The station’s car park, managed by APCOA Parking UK, offers free parking with 22 spaces, including one accessible bay. While there are no accessible taxis directly available, ample space in front of the station provides ease for drop-off and pick-up points. Bicycle enthusiasts will appreciate the sheltered cycle stands adjacent to Platform 1.
